In response on the gestural character of motion Original artwork for sale paintings, artists Kenneth Noland and Ellsworth Kelly established paintings termed Tricky Edge Abstraction, so named as they emphasised distinct types according to straightforward designs and monochromatic, clean paint application with brilliant colors squeezed straight from your tube. This system consciously eradicated the non-public elements from Abstract Expressionism.

The Op Art motion of the sixties centered on the creation of works that appeared to maneuver because of coloration relationships and styles. Therefore, although epitomizing an allover canvas like Jackson Pollock, it absolutely was with a complete lack of desire in a metaphorical expression of self. Minimalism is usually considered to be a form of extreme abstraction in that there was no intention of meaning apart from the self-referentiality of the article as a result of an emphasis on sort and product.
